This is where our pneumatic SEIL manipulator is used to move front and rear windows. To cover a large working area, it can be moved along a light-duty crane rail system. A telescopic extension was integrated into the bridge rail to allow the manipulator to navigate around the hall columns. The lifting motion is controlled by a pneumatic balancing system to ensure movements that are as smooth and precise as possible. The windows are swiveled continuously using a joystick on the integrated control unit. This makes it easy to adjust the windows to the various angles required by the special load carrier and the storage configuration.
